FITCHBURG, MA - The State of New York Office of General Services (OGS) has deployed Chevin Fleet Solutions' FleetWave to gain control over fleet operating costs.
The State of New York Office of General Services chose the web-based fleet management information system to manage the acquisition and management of its diverse fleet of more than 27,000 vehicles. The OGS is mandated by the State legislature to provide vehicles and related services to New York agencies, authorities, and universities across the State, and provide comprehensive services that include:
Vehicle procurement.
Acquisition of alternative-fuel vehicles.
Alternative fuel management.
NY State fuel card program and services.
Insurance, risk, and accident management services.
State-wide communications for all fleet-related policies and procedures are tracked and consolidated on a monthly basis, streamlining labor-intensive process, according to Chevin.
Through the use of potent technologies such as automated VIN Decoding and integration to external maintenance providers as well as conventional and alternative fuel providers, OGS has improved fleet data accuracy and finally has a harmonized view of complete operational details across the State.
